Output 64ac5d60052b218332756ae34529a4eaf69260f33c4cdd3300ee50f2e5456834:12

value
33721038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f1c2d6dccf85aa3088dafb6ea6a1594d3cec44 OP_EQUAL
address
MDTQPo4zBUGFge81xDmnbrC7tPeWNpRfjy
transaction
64ac5d60052b218332756ae34529a4eaf69260f33c4cdd3300ee50f2e5456834
spent
true